Recently, Pascal was spotted at the "No Kings" rally in Los Angeles, where he attended alongside other notable figures like Kerry Washington. The event was part of a nationwide protest against perceived authoritarian leadership, and Pascal's presence was significant, especially given his family ties to the transgender community. According to reports from TMZ and AOL, his sister, Lux Pascal, being trans, has fueled his vocal support for LGBTQ+ rights.
Pascal's appearance at the rally included holding a symbolic sign with a drag queen giving a side-eye to an image of Donald Trump, clearly mocking what many see as Trump's authoritarian style. This public stance aligns with his previous criticism of figures like J.K. Rowling over her views on trans individuals.
